"One step at a time. Somebody is going to call me tomorrow from the UFC about my next fight, and it's going to be my next opponent. Of course, in the future, I want to be UFC Champion, but sooner or later, it doesn't matter. I can be in line, so I'm good. I still have a few more years in the UFC... It's totally up to the UFC. I can wait, I can fight forever."
-Andrei Arlovski talks about what's next for him following a thrilling win over Travis Browne at UFC 187 during the post-fight press conference (transcribed by MMAJunkie.com).
Penick's Analysis: I have to give Arlovski the credit I didn't give him into the Browne fight last weekend. He looked excellent on Saturday night, even though he got clipped, but even with that knock down he rebounded well and kept up on the attack himself. It's very possible he'll be getting another shot at the UFC Heavyweight Championship before his run is done, and that's an absolutely insane reality given where he was just a few short years ago.
